Instrument Panel Indicators
Malfunction Indicator
Lamp
If this indicator comes on while
driving, it means one of the engine's
emissions control systems may have
a problem. For more information, see
page 289.
Low Oil Pressure
Indicator
The engine can be severely damaged
if this indicator flashes or stays on
when the engine is running. For
more information, see page
Charging System
Indicator
If this indicator comes on when the
engine is running, the battery is not
being charged. For more information,
see page

Supplemental Restraint
System Indicator
This indicator comes on for several
seconds when you turn the ignition
switch to the ON (II) position. If it
comes on at any other time, it
indicates a potential problem with
your front airbags. This indicator will
also alert you to a potential problem
with your side airbags, passenger' s
side airbag automatic cutoff system,
side curtain airbags, automatic seat
belt tensioners, driver' s seat position
.
sensor, and the front passenger' s
288
weight sensors. For more
information, see page
